WELLBEING MAIL ART CAMPAIGN

Sign up through April 30th

Receive your original Mail Art in May!

CAPTION: Melinda Smith Altshuler, Sara’s Eye, 2021. 6 x 5 inches. Collage: tissue box board, appropriated images.

 

In partnership with WeRise.LA for Mental Health Awareness month in May, six artists (Sabine Pearlman, M Susan Broussard, Deborah Lynn Irmas, Gregg Chadwick, and Melinda Smith Altshuler) will create original prints and works of art with messages of wellbeing and self-compassion that will be mailed out to over 300 healthcare professionals and frontline workers in our community for our Wellbeing Mail Art Campaign. Rebecca Youssef will create a “Feel Good” artist’s ‘zine, and Nicola Goode will produce a collage poster of Black Lives Matter spontaneous protest art that will be distributed to Santa Monica and West Side neighborhoods.

A companion exhibition and related projects called Recovery Justice: Being Well funded by the City of Santa Monica will be on view at 18th Street Arts Center’s Airport Campus (3026 Airport Avenue, Santa Monica) from March 29 - July 16, available by public appointment. 

 

Partners include the Community Clinics Association of Los Angeles County (CACLAC), St. John’s Well Child & Family Center, and the Community Corporation of Santa Monica.
